From 1 April 2026, Discretionary Housing Payments (DHP) were replaced by the The Crisis and Resilience Fund (CRF). This provides financial support to help with rent or housing costs.
You can apply for the CRF if you currently get either;
- Housing Benefit
- the housing element of Universal Credit
The CRF can help people with a range of housing costs, including;
- rent shortfalls - the difference between your rent liability and your income, including any benefits
- rent deposits
- rent in advance
- removal costs
